probably one of my most favorite shots of the night.

For the photo geeks, this was shot at 1/60 sec at f/4.5, ISO 640 at 16mm focal length,  using Canon 5D Mark II 16-35 f2.8L. I used a Vivitar 285, set at 1/16th power and placed on the dashboard. Actually, my 2nd shooter Ron was holding it. If you look closer, you’d see him.

I used 2 pocket wizards, one on the flash and one on camera to fire the strobe.

There you go,,, i try to keep things simple, OR NOT:)
